首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何查找从第几天开始一列的值为True?

要查找从第几天开始一列的值为True,可以使用编程语言中的循环结构和条件判断来实现。以下是一个示例的Python代码:

代码语言:txt
复制
def find_start_day(data):
    for i in range(len(data)):
        if data[i] == True:
            return i + 1
    return -1

# 示例数据
column_data = [False, False, True, False, True, True, False]

start_day = find_start_day(column_data)
if start_day != -1:
    print("从第{}天开始一列的值为True。".format(start_day))
else:
    print("未找到一列的值为True。")

这段代码中,find_start_day函数接受一个列表作为参数,通过遍历列表中的元素,找到第一个值为True的元素所在的索引位置,并返回该索引位置加1,即为从第几天开始一列的值为True。如果列表中不存在值为True的元素,则返回-1表示未找到。

对于这个问题,腾讯云的相关产品和服务可能与云计算领域的问答内容无关,因此不提供相关产品和链接。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券